Provides rides for any purpose, to all people, and no membership is required.

The Public Transit program offers convenient and accessible transportation options for older adults in need of non-emergency medical transportation. This program provides a range of services, including taxi rides, private car transportation, and paratransit services via bus or train. Riders can schedule their trips in advance, with options for on-demand scheduling available as well. Payment for the Public Transit program can be made through insurance, vouchers, coupons, donations, and various payment methods, including cash, credit card, check, or pre-payment. Pricing varies based on the destination and the rider's qualifications, ensuring that disabled riders receive discounted rates. The program also offers membership and flat fee options, providing flexibility for older adults with different transportation needs. One of the key features of the Public Transit program is its commitment to passenger convenience and comfort. Riders can expect door-to-door transportation services, assistance with packages, and the option for shared rides. Service animals are welcome, and drivers are available to wait for passengers during errands or appointments. Overall, the Public Transit program strives to meet the diverse transportation needs of older adults while prioritizing safety, reliability, and affordability.


Service Area

Provides curb-to-curb demand-response service in Buckingham, Fluvanna, Louisa, Nelson, and rural Albemarle counties.
